Resolution: None Priority: 5 Submitted By: Roberto Bagnara (bagnara) Assigned to: Nobody/Anonymous (nobody) Summary: Including cinterf.h pollutes the name space
Initial Comment: Including cinterf.h causes the definition of macros min() and max(). This is quite likely to clash with user code or other library headers (this happens for my C++ code, in particular). The workaround is to always undefine that macros after including cinterf.h, but I believe a better solution should be implemented in cinterf.h itself.

Comment By: David S. Warren (dwarren)
Date: 2004-02-02 20:34
Message: Logged In: YES user_id=13069
Fixed. Changed min and max macros to xsb_min and xsb_max to avoid possible name conflicts.
